Oral Health and Pregnancy: A Comprehensive Consideration

In this special Compendium eBook, David C. Alexander, BDS, MSc, DDPH, and colleagues present a series of five continuing education (CE) articles on the importance of dental care before, during, and after pregnancy, both for mothers and children. Download to earn 10 CEU for $49 now!

FEATURED CONTENT

CE Article 1 summarizes guidelines for dental care as a safe and essential part of a healthy pregnancy.

CE Article 2 offers a patient-centered approach to counseling and behavioral change for women in a healthy pregnancy.

CE Article 3 explains the importance of taking an interdisciplinary approach to oral healthcare during pregnancy by collaborating with the woman’s perinatal team.

CE Article 4 further defines the dental team’s role in maternal and child oral health.

CE Article 5 completes this series by focusing on management of oral health in a complicated pregnancy.
